Latest Patents

Chay Nil holds a patent for a catheter balloon molding device. This innovative mold features a cavity specifically designed to accommodate a hollow parison that can be expanded to create a balloon. The design includes a cone region and a body region, with the cone region receiving heat at elevated temperatures, enhancing the molding process.
